Walter H. ?Wally? Kienbaum

Walter H. “Wally” Kienbaum, 72, of Kenosha, passed away peacefully on Wednesday, Oct. 5, 2011, at Kenosha Medical Center surrounded by his loving family.
Born on March 6, 1939, in Merrill, he was the son of the late Walter and Mary (Orcelleto) Kienbaum.
On Sept. 12, 1959, he married Phyllis “Boots” Ristau in Merrill. Later that year they moved to Kenosha.
Prior to his retirement in 2001, Walter was employed as an inspector at AMC/Chrysler for over 42 years.
Wally served in the National Guard. He was a former member of the Moose Lodge and was a member of the UAW Local 72 Retirees. He loved to read books and do crossword puzzles, but most of all he loved to spend time with his family.
He is survived by his wife, Phyllis “Boots” of Kenosha; his two children, Lori (David, Jr.) Eddy of Merrillan, WI, and Tom (Susan Tolliver) Kienbaum of Kenosha; five grandchildren, David Eddy III, Kristine Eddy, Chris Tolliver, Michael Kienbaum and Alyssa Kienbaum; three great-grandchildren, Elizabeth Gottschalk, Hillary Eddy and Lindsay Eddy; and a brother, Robert (Carol) Kienbaum of Merrill. He is further survived by several nieces and nephews; extended great-grandchildren; a sister-in-law, Karen (Glen) Krueger; and a brother-in-law, Dennis Ristau.
Wally was preceded in death by his parents and a sister, Katherine Coty.
